The Patient “Long Game”
Time and Patience. I always feel short of time and I struggle with patience.
Moses talks to the Israelites in Deuteronomy about their history. He takes them all the way back to God’s promises to Abraham, Isaac and Jacob followed by Jacob’s son Joseph taken as a slave in Egypt. Then after about 20 years of being a slave and wrongful imprisonment, he gains great power and all of Jacob’s family (Israel) settles in Egypt. After many years, the new pharaoh starts to fear them because they became so numerous, and he forces them into slavery. They miraculously leave Egypt but end up spending 40 years in the wilderness. The time between Abraham being given the promise and entering the “promised land” was 470 years. It’s a remarkable, long journey filled with sadness and joy.
God was not in a hurry. All the experiences of life in the desert were in preparation for entering the promised land. Abraham was promised that the number of his offspring would be as many as the “sand on the seashore”. Clearly that would not be Isaac alone. We calculated earlier the number of men who left Egypt was 600,000 so the population would have been approximately 2M people. Time was required for that. The people also needed to learn how to be God’s chosen people and even that was a tough lesson.
I mentioned Joseph. Joseph was sold as a slave to Egypt . There was 20 years of preparation before Joseph was used by God to bring the rest of his family (Israel) to settle in Egypt.
Moses was away from Egypt 40 years before he returned to Egypt to be used by God to rescue the people of Israel.

God is not concerned with time and He is very patient. His plan will be fulfilled but when He’s ready. Within God’s long term plan there are smaller lessons to be learned and things needing to be fulfilled in God’s time and with patience. So as we live in the now enjoying God’s amazing creation, we fulfill God’s short term plans in order to fulfill His long term plan.
The nation of Israel waited for God’s plan to bring the Messiah. It was 2000 years between Abraham receiving the promise of the “promised land” and Jesus, the Messiah, being born in Bethlehem. It’s now been over 2000 years since Jesus' death and resurrection and the long term plan has not yet been fulfilled.
